Celebration of Women and the Steelpan Art Form

“From my perspective I personally feel it (Panorama) is indeed a blessing. The people that I have met over the years, there is a likelihood I would never see again. I’ve got the chance to perform in front of thousands of people and to travel to places I never thought I’d visit. There is no better vibe or atmosphere in any other activity, like Panorama!”

At an early age she fell in love with the steelpan instrument. Now an adult the love affair continues. In an exclusive interview with When Steel Talks - panist and musical director Ashley Gateson-Amankwah shares her experiences and passion for the steelpan instrument, its music, the art form and more.
